Choosing the Right Design for Small Tattoos
When it comes to small tattoos, choosing a design that complements your style and body size is essential. Opting for intricate yet delicate patterns can make a small tattoo stand out without overwhelming your skin real estate. Geometric tattoos, for instance, offer a modern and minimalist aesthetic that lends itself well to smaller areas. These designs often feature precise lines and shapes, creating a visually appealing composition that fits seamlessly on wrists, ankles, or behind ears.

Step-by-Step Guide to Applying Small Tattoos Safely
Applying small tattoos with precision requires a step-by-step approach to ensure safety and satisfaction. Start by preparing your skin: cleanse the area thoroughly with antibacterial soap and water, and consider using an alcohol pad for extra disinfection. This prevents potential infections and ensures a clean canvas for your tattoo.
